Exports by Country

The biggest shipments were from South Africa (X cubic meters), Swaziland (X cubic meters), Tanzania (X cubic meters) and Mozambique (X cubic meters), together reaching X% of total export. It was distantly followed by Angola (X cubic meters), comprising a X% share of total exports. The following exporters - Democratic Republic of the Congo (X cubic meters) and Madagascar (X cubic meters) - each accounted for a X% share of total exports.

From 2012 to 2022, the biggest increases were recorded for Angola (with a CAGR of X%), while shipments for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.

In value terms, the largest sawnwood supplying countries in SADC were Swaziland ($X), South Africa ($X) and Tanzania ($X), with a combined X% share of total exports. Angola, Mozambique, Democratic Republic of the Congo and Madagascar lagged somewhat behind, together comprising a further X%.

Angola, with a CAGR of X%, recorded the highest rates of growth with regard to the value of exports, among the main exporting countries over the period under review, while shipments for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.

Imports by Country

South Africa was the major importer of sawnwood in SADC, with the volume of imports resulting at X cubic meters, which was approx. X% of total imports in 2022. Mauritius (X cubic meters) took the second position in the ranking, followed by Botswana (X cubic meters), Mozambique (X cubic meters) and Namibia (X cubic meters). All these countries together took near X% share of total imports. The following importers - Tanzania (X cubic meters) and Seychelles (X cubic meters) - each finished at a X% share of total imports.

From 2012 to 2022, average annual rates of growth with regard to sawnwood imports into South Africa stood at X%. At the same time, Namibia (X%), Tanzania (X%), Botswana (X%) and Seychelles (X%) displayed positive paces of growth. Moreover, Namibia emerged as the fastest-growing importer imported in SADC, with a CAGR of X% from 2012-2022. Mauritius experienced a relatively flat trend pattern. By contrast, Mozambique (X%) illustrated a downward trend over the same period. Botswana (X p.p.), Mauritius (X p.p.), Namibia (X p.p.), Tanzania (X p.p.) and Seychelles (X p.p.) significantly strengthened its position in terms of the total imports, while Mozambique and South Africa saw its share reduced by X% and X% from 2012 to 2022, respectively.
